AI-generated deep summary by claude@2026-07, 2026-07-09 · read from full text

This correspondence reports a comparative study measuring serum HE4 and CA125 in 46 patients with ovarian cancer and 21 patients with endometriosis (12 ovarian endometrioma and 9 non-ovarian endometriosis), using an automated chemiluminescent immunoassay for CA125 and an ELISA for HE4. HE4 levels were significantly higher in ovarian cancer than in endometriosis (810.0 vs 49.4 pM), and HE4 performed better than CA125 for differentiating ovarian cancer from ovarian endometrioma based on ROC analysis (AUC 0.85 vs 0.77). A key limitation acknowledged by the authors’ presented data is that many ovarian endometrioma cases had CA125 above 35 U/ml, yet only one had HE4 above the reference-range upper limit (70 pM), implying performance depends on threshold behavior in this cohort. This paper is centrally about endometriosis — it evaluates serum HE4 as a diagnostic discriminator between ovarian cancer and ovarian endometriotic cysts (endometrioma), motivated by CA125 elevations commonly seen in endometriosis.

More importantly, receiver operator characteristic curve analysis showed that HE4 has a significantly higher area under the curve as compared with CA125 (0.85 vs 0.77, Po0.0001) for differentiating ovarian cancer from ovarian endometrioma. The results of our investigation confirm that HE4 is a promising marker for the early differentiation of ovarian cancer from ovarian endometriotic cysts, showing better diagnostic performances than CA125.
